MCP Tools Reference: gmailmcp.googleapis.com

כלי: get_thread

אחזור שרשור אימייל ספציפי מחשבון Gmail של המשתמש המאומת, כולל רשימה של ההודעות בשרשור.

בדוגמה הבאה אפשר לראות איך משתמשים ב-curl כדי להפעיל את כלי ה-MCP‏ get_thread.

בקשת Curl
curl --location 'https://gmailmcp.googleapis.com/mcp' \
--header 'content-type: application/json' \
--header 'accept: application/json, text/event-stream' \
--data '{
  "method": "tools/call",
  "params": {
    "name": "get_thread",
    "arguments": {
      // provide these details according to the tool MCP specification
    }
  },
  "jsonrpc": "2.0",
  "id": 1
}'
                

סכימת קלט

הודעת בקשה ל-RPC של GetThread.

GetThreadRequest

ייצוג JSON
{
  "threadId": string,
  "messageFormat": enum (MessageFormat)
}
שדות
threadId

string

חובה. המזהה הייחודי של השרשור שיש לאחזר.

messageFormat

enum (MessageFormat)

אופציונלי. מציין את הפורמט של ההודעות שמוחזרות בשרשור. ברירת המחדל היא FULL_CONTENT.

סכימת פלט

שרשור שמכיל רשימה של הודעות.

חוט תפירה

ייצוג JSON
{
  "id": string,
  "messages": [
    {
      object (Message)
    }
  ]
}
שדות
id

string

המזהה הייחודי של השרשור.

messages[]

object (Message)

רשימת ההודעות בשרשור, בסדר כרונולוגי.

שליחת הודעה

ייצוג JSON
{
  "id": string,
  "snippet": string,
  "subject": string,
  "sender": string,
  "toRecipients": [
    string
  ],
  "ccRecipients": [
    string
  ],
  "date": string,
  "plaintextBody": string
}
שדות
id

string

המזהה הייחודי של ההודעה.

snippet

string

קטע מגוף ההודעה.

subject

string

נושא ההודעה שחולץ מהכותרות:

sender

string

כתובת האימייל של השולח.

toRecipients[]

string

כתובות האימייל של הנמענים.

ccRecipients[]

string

כתובות אימייל של נמענים בשדה 'עותק'.

date

string

תאריך ההודעה בפורמט ISO 8601‏ (YYYY-MM-DD).

plaintextBody

string

תוכן מלא של גוף ההודעה, מאוכלס רק אם MessageFormat היה FULL_CONTENT.

הערות על כלי

רמז הרסני: ❌ | רמז אידמפוטנטי: ✅ | רמז לקריאה בלבד: ✅ | רמז לעולם פתוח: ❌